Address

Vb8VpCyVkRXJem23oNYNKrkpRPneDNZQQE

0 VTC

Confirmed
Total Received23.40578373 VTC23852.37 IDR
Total Sent23.40578373 VTC23852.37 IDR
Final Balance0 VTC0.00 IDR
No. Transactions2

Transactions

Vb8VpCyVkRXJem23oNYNKrkpRPneDNZQQE23.40578373 VTC21081.14 IDR23852.37 IDR
 
VqJiyLc4be3zYGNgRYEm2D6hyNQ3pSvLwT23.09350996 VTC20799.88 IDR23534.13 IDR
VcFuKqyMWW5zcr13HS89NzQFLN5xeb878L0.31127377 VTC280.36 IDR317.21 IDR
VdfdKgHKyoESGv5nxweN4z9koQeo2A2HXn25.86814991 VTC23298.95 IDR26361.71 IDR
 
VkSuKmqEGQPXBUSNxfvJus2F1gmC4R5wFT2.46136618 VTC2216.91 IDR2508.33 IDR
Vb8VpCyVkRXJem23oNYNKrkpRPneDNZQQE23.40578373 VTC21081.14 IDR23852.37 IDR